Hey Gunther quick question how long does it take for new growth to lock up after you retwist your dreads btw you know encourage me to get dreads I’ve always wanted them since I was 14 I’m 17 now and you encourage me to actually do it so thank you vro
Basically alot of people do not cover this but retwisting does not make your new growth lock up, your hair does that by itself over time, retwisting just keeps your hair in its respected sections and neat temporarily. I'd say itll take about 2 months max for you to notice any kind of locking if your hair is somewhat coarse, it can take alot longer depending on your hair type. I talk about it in some of my youtube vids, hope this helps
